Understanding the Licensing Landscape

When considering a casino operating outside of UK jurisdiction, the licensing authority becomes paramount. Different licensing bodies have varying levels of oversight and player protection measures. For example, casinos licensed in Malta are often considered reputable due to the Malta Gaming Authority’s relatively stringent standards. Conversely, a Curacao license, while common, generally has a lighter touch in terms of regulation. It’s essential to research the licensing body and understand what regulations they enforce regarding fair gaming, responsible gambling, and dispute resolution. A lack of a recognized license should be a significant red flag, suggesting the operator may not be committed to player safety or fair practices. Players should look for details about the license on the casino's website, often found in the footer, and independently verify its validity through the licensing authority's official register. Ignoring this step can lead to potential issues with withdrawals, unfair game play, or a lack of recourse in case of a dispute.

The Role of Independent Auditors

Beyond the licensing jurisdiction, look for casinos that utilize independent auditing services. Companies like eCOGRA and iTech Labs regularly test casino games to ensure their Random Number Generators (RNGs) are functioning correctly, guaranteeing fair and unbiased outcomes. An audit seal displayed on the casino website is a positive sign, demonstrating a commitment to transparency and fair play. These auditors don’t just test the RNGs, but also examine the casino's payout percentages and overall security protocols. The presence of such audits significantly enhances player confidence and provides an extra layer of assurance that the games are legitimate and the casino operates with integrity. Regularly updated audit reports are even better, showing a continued commitment to maintaining high standards.

Understanding Wagering Requirements

Wagering requirements are arguably the most important aspect of any casino bonus. They represent the number of times you must wager the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it amount) before you can withdraw any associated winnings. For example, a bonus with a 35x wagering requirement means you must wager 35 times the bonus amount. A lower wagering requirement is generally more favorable. It's also crucial to understand which games contribute to the wagering requirement.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games and live dealer games may contribute a smaller percentage, or not at all. Always read the fine print and calculate the total amount you need to wager before accepting a bonus. Ignoring this step can lead to frustration and disappointment when you try to withdraw your winnings.
